SAP MaxDB
SAP MaxDB provides various tools and methods for the analysis of database performance bottlenecks and monitoring current database activities. Some of these tools were originally developed only for testing and analysis in SAP MaxDB development, but can also be used by experienced database administrators for performance analysis. The following are of particular importance for this performance analysis:
The Database Analyzer program for analyzing performance bottlenecks.
The Command Monitor diagnosis function for identifying long-running or poorly-processed SQL statements.
The Resource Monitor diagnosis function for measuring all long-running SQL statements.
In SAP systems, you can control and analyze all functions and results using transaction DBACOCKPIT and DB50. The output here is formatted in a user-friendly way. You can also control the functions by means of SQL statements. However, the evaluation requires knowledge of the system tables used as well as the interpretation of the data contained therein. Database Studio provides a quick overview of the function(s) that is (are) currently active. You find entries for Command Monitor, Resource Monitor and Database Analyzer, together with the respective status.

DBA Cockpit
The DBA Cockpit is a platform-independent tool that you can use to monitor and administer your database. It provides a graphical user interface (GUI) for all actions and covers all aspects of handling a database system landscape. You can run the DBA Cockpit locally on an SAP NetWeaver-based system by calling the DBACOCKPIT transaction.
Universal to all Databases
Analysis depends on the Database Version and Release
Database Configuration and layout can be checked
SQL Cache can be analysed for most expensive SQL
A HTTP Connection is necessary to access the Web-Dynpro DBACOCKPIT, for some customers this is the only option to access the dbacockpit
